  • Is it common to pay with cash or card in Argentina?

    While credit cards are widely accepted in larger cities and tourist areas, it's still a good idea to carry some Argentine pesos, especially in smaller towns or for smaller purchases. Many businesses may prefer cash, and you'll find better exchange rates paying in cash. Keep in mind that Argentina has experienced economic instability in the past, and the best way to pay can vary.

  • Is the driving culture in Argentina considered safe for tourists?

    Driving in Argentina can be challenging for tourists. Traffic laws are sometimes not strictly enforced, and driving styles can be more aggressive than in some other countries. Renting a car is an option, but many tourists opt for organized tours or public transportation, especially in larger cities. If you choose to drive, be extra cautious and aware of your surroundings.

  • Are there any important traditions to honor while traveling in Argentina?

    Argentine culture is warm and welcoming. It's polite to greet people with a 'hola' and a handshake or kiss on the cheek (depending on your relationship with them). Sharing mate (a traditional herbal tea) is a social ritual, and accepting an offered cup is a sign of friendship. Punctuality isn't always strictly adhered to, so be flexible and patient.
  • Are there any noteworthy festivals unique to Argentina?

    Argentina has many vibrant festivals! The Carnival celebrations are huge, especially in Gualeguaychú, known for its elaborate parades. In the north, there are various religious festivals celebrating patron saints. Many towns also have their own unique festivals throughout the year, celebrating local produce or crafts.
  • What areas offer the best experiences for a full week in Argentina?

    A week allows for a taste of Argentina's diversity! Consider a trip that combines Buenos Aires (3 days for culture and tango), followed by a flight to Bariloche in Patagonia (3 days for lake and mountain scenery) and a day trip to Iguazu Falls. This gives you a good balance of city life and natural wonders.

  • What are the emergency contacts for medical or security situations in Argentina?

    For medical emergencies, dial 107. For security emergencies, dial 911. It is advisable to have travel insurance that includes emergency medical evacuation.
